Scope of Services
We require the services of an Operations Readiness Consultant (Outside of IR35) to provide independent contract services to support the multi-discipline delivery of diverse energy projects (typically at conceptual / pre-FEED project stages) to ensure facilities are designed and constructed in such a way as to improve Operability, Reliability and Maintainability (ORM) during operations.
The scope of services requires providing broad technical inputs and project engineering on a range of energy projects, from traditional upstream oil and gas to emerging energy transition developments, and shall include:
- Provide guidance to project execution team on Operations Readiness and Assurance processes and related issues throughout all phases of the project. This includes defining readiness criteria, quality gates and operational acceptance standards
- Develop operability, reliability, maintainability and asset management strategies across various project phases
- Establish preventative maintenance and inspection routines for onshore and offshore assets.
- Prepare OPEX estimates and budgets for operations phase.
- Provide assurance for operations to ensure compliance with industry and regulatory standards.
- Lead operations readiness reviews and operational acceptance activities
- Ensure all tasks and deliverables meet operational readiness requirements before transitioning to stable operations
- Manage threat and anomaly registers and risk registers for operations.
- Support Commissioning and Startup teams for the development of pre-commissioning and commissioning readiness plans and procedures.

Genesis globally is managed within core services lines (Early Advisory Solutions, Development Solutions and Asset Lifecycle Solutions) and key markets (Low Carbon, CO2 Management & Renewables and Upstream & Downstream Oil & Gas). The Genesis UK Operating Centre (with offices in Aberdeen and London) is organised into 8 core delivery teams. In this role you would join the Operations Readiness & Assurance Delivery Team. This team, in supporting Genesis global delivery of advisory services, currently comprises circa 50+; engineers, project engineers and study managers, managed in six core delivery groups comprising; Project Engineering / Piping & Layouts, Mechanical and Construction / Electrical / Control, Instrumentation & Telecommunications / Structural, Civil and Marine / Decommissioning.
